The report, as filed

Standing outside saw a ball of light shoot so fast in a downward position my best guess is it was some place close to the North it was not high in the sky either it happened so fast! Than shortly after you see helicopters with possible police lights several circle area! I don’t know what city it was in but like I said near the Mountains towards the North possibly near Hacienda Heights I’m not entirely sure of location but we saw it and it was really nothing like I’ve seen before!

Held as-reported from National UFO Reporting Center (record NUFORC #151420). Witness text is preserved verbatim, including its spelling; nothing is edited beyond formatting.
